Before recording the video to DVD or Blu-ray disc ■ When you record DVD or Blu-ray discs, please use only discs recommended by the Drive manufacturer. ■ Do not set the working drive to a slow device like a USB 1.1 hard disk drive or it will fail to write DVD or Blu-ray discs. ■ Do not perform any of the following actions: ■ Operate the computer for any other function, including using a mouse or touchpad, or closing/opening the display panel. ■ Bump or cause vibration to the computer. ■ Use the Mode control button and Audio/Video control button to reproduce music or voice. ■ Open the DVD/BD drive. ■ Install, remove or connect external devices, including items such as a Secure Digital(SD), Secure Digital High Capacity(SDHC), Memory Stick(MS), Memory Stick PRO(MS PRO), MultiMediaCard(MMC),USB device, external monitor or an optical digital device. ■ Please verify your disc after recording important data. ■ DVD+R/+RW disc cannot be written in VR format. ■ Not support to output VCD and SVCD format. 3. About recorded DVDs and Blu-ray discs ■ When playing your recorded DVD-Video/VR on your computer, please use the DVD playback application. ■ When playing your recorded Blu-ray Disc on your computer, please use the Corel WinDVD BD for TOSHIBA. ■ If you use an over-used rewritable disc, the full formatting might be locked. Please use a brand new disc. ■ Some DVD drives for personal computers or other DVD players may not be able to read DVD-R/+R/-RW/+RW/-RAM discs. ■ Some BD drives for personal computers or other Blu-ray disc players may not be able to read BD-R/RE discs. 4-24 User's Manual
